Raw Vegan Apple Ravioli Recipe (Carol Brotman)

UTENSILS: Peeler and slicer (not necessary) Blender Dehydrator (Oven)











INGREDIENTS: Apples Pecans Coconut oil Cinnamon Sweetener (Honey, Agave, Maple syrup) Water












METHOD: Peel apples and slice very thinly.   In a large bowl lay out a thin layer of apple slices.   Cover this layer with Coconut oil, Sweetener and Cinnamon.   Place another layer of apple slices on top and cover again with Coconut oil, Sweetener and Cinnamon.     Repeat this step again.    Place in a dehydrator (or oven if you don’t have a dehydrator) for 15 minutes while you make the filling.






Filling: Put 1 cup of pecans, Sweetener, Coconut oil and water(not too much unless it gets to dry) into a blender. Now stuff the apple slices with your filling, take one apple slice and put filling in the middle then place another apple slice on top and press it down slightly. You can add more cinnamon on top if you like. Then place back in the dehydrator for around two hours depending on how soft or crispy you like.  (when  using a cooker the timings will be at least half depending on the heat setting. Preferably you want it as low as possible to keep it as raw as possible.)
